currbarscount函数的用法(troughbars函数用法)
# 简介在编程和数据分析中,`currbarscount` 是一个常见的函数或方法,用于获取当前数据集中的条目数量。该函数通常用于处理时间序列数据、金融数据或其他需要按时间顺序排列的数据结构。通过了解 `currbarscount` 的用法,可以更高效地编写代码,优化数据分析流程。---# 多级标题1. currbarscount 的基本概念 2. currbarscount 的语法与参数 3. 使用 currbarscount 的场景 4. 示例代码详解 5. 注意事项 ---## 1. currbarscount 的基本概念`currbarscount` 函数的主要作用是返回当前数据集中包含的条目数量。这里的“条目”通常指的是数据的时间点或数据记录的数量。例如,在股票交易中,每个时间点对应一个数据条目,`currbarscount` 可以用来统计从开始到当前时间点的数据总量。---## 2. currbarscount 的语法与参数虽然不同平台对 `currbarscount` 的具体实现可能略有差异,但其基本语法通常是:```plaintext int currbarscount() ```### 参数: -
无参数
:`currbarscount` 本身不接受任何输入参数,直接返回当前数据集的条目数量。---## 3. 使用 currbarscount 的场景`currbarscount` 函数在以下场景中非常有用:1.
数据预处理
:在进行数据分析之前,先检查数据集的大小,确保数据完整。 2.
动态调整算法逻辑
:根据数据条目的数量动态调整算法的运行逻辑。 3.
绘制图表
:在绘制时间序列图时,可以通过 `currbarscount` 来控制图表的范围。 4.
条件判断
:在某些情况下,需要判断数据是否足够用于计算或分析。---## 4. 示例代码详解以下是几个常见平台中使用 `currbarscount` 的示例代码:### 示例 1: Python 中的使用(假设存在类似功能)```python def get_data_length(data):# 获取数据集的长度data_length = len(data)print(f"数据集长度为: {data_length}")# 假设 data 是一个列表 data = [1, 2, 3, 4, 5] get_data_length(data) ```### 示例 2: MQL4 (MetaQuotes Language 4) 中的使用```mql4 void OnStart() {// 获取当前历史数据的条目数量int bars_count = Bars;Print("当前历史数据条目数量为: ", bars_count); } ```### 示例 3: JavaScript 中的使用(假设存在类似功能)```javascript function getDataLength(data) {const dataLength = data.length;console.log(`数据集长度为: ${dataLength}`); }// 假设 data 是一个数组 const data = [10, 20, 30, 40, 50]; getDataLength(data); ```---## 5. 注意事项1.
数据集类型
:不同的平台可能对数据集的定义不同,因此在使用 `currbarscount` 之前,应确认数据集的具体类型。 2.
空数据集
:如果数据集为空,`currbarscount` 返回的结果可能是 0,需在代码中添加相应的判断逻辑。 3.
跨平台兼容性
:不同平台可能有不同的命名约定或实现方式,例如在某些平台上可能是 `CurrentBarsCount()` 或其他形式,请根据实际情况调整代码。---# 总结`currbarscount` 是一个简单而实用的函数,能够帮助开发者快速获取数据集的条目数量。无论是在金融数据分析、时间序列处理还是其他领域,合理使用 `currbarscount` 都能提高代码的效率和可读性。通过理解其语法、应用场景以及注意事项,可以更好地将其融入到实际开发中。
简介在编程和数据分析中,`currbarscount` 是一个常见的函数或方法,用于获取当前数据集中的条目数量。该函数通常用于处理时间序列数据、金融数据或其他需要按时间顺序排列的数据结构。通过了解 `currbarscount` 的用法,可以更高效地编写代码,优化数据分析流程。---
多级标题1. currbarscount 的基本概念 2. currbarscount 的语法与参数 3. 使用 currbarscount 的场景 4. 示例代码详解 5. 注意事项 ---
1. currbarscount 的基本概念`currbarscount` 函数的主要作用是返回当前数据集中包含的条目数量。这里的“条目”通常指的是数据的时间点或数据记录的数量。例如,在股票交易中,每个时间点对应一个数据条目,`currbarscount` 可以用来统计从开始到当前时间点的数据总量。---
2. currbarscount 的语法与参数虽然不同平台对 `currbarscount` 的具体实现可能略有差异,但其基本语法通常是:```plaintext int currbarscount() ```
参数: - **无参数**:`currbarscount` 本身不接受任何输入参数,直接返回当前数据集的条目数量。---
3. 使用 currbarscount 的场景`currbarscount` 函数在以下场景中非常有用:1. **数据预处理**:在进行数据分析之前,先检查数据集的大小,确保数据完整。 2. **动态调整算法逻辑**:根据数据条目的数量动态调整算法的运行逻辑。 3. **绘制图表**:在绘制时间序列图时,可以通过 `currbarscount` 来控制图表的范围。 4. **条件判断**:在某些情况下,需要判断数据是否足够用于计算或分析。---
4. 示例代码详解以下是几个常见平台中使用 `currbarscount` 的示例代码:
示例 1: Python 中的使用(假设存在类似功能)```python def get_data_length(data):
获取数据集的长度data_length = len(data)print(f"数据集长度为: {data_length}")
假设 data 是一个列表 data = [1, 2, 3, 4, 5] get_data_length(data) ```
示例 2: MQL4 (MetaQuotes Language 4) 中的使用```mql4 void OnStart() {// 获取当前历史数据的条目数量int bars_count = Bars;Print("当前历史数据条目数量为: ", bars_count); } ```
示例 3: JavaScript 中的使用(假设存在类似功能)```javascript function getDataLength(data) {const dataLength = data.length;console.log(`数据集长度为: ${dataLength}`); }// 假设 data 是一个数组 const data = [10, 20, 30, 40, 50]; getDataLength(data); ```---
5. 注意事项1. **数据集类型**:不同的平台可能对数据集的定义不同,因此在使用 `currbarscount` 之前,应确认数据集的具体类型。 2. **空数据集**:如果数据集为空,`currbarscount` 返回的结果可能是 0,需在代码中添加相应的判断逻辑。 3. **跨平台兼容性**:不同平台可能有不同的命名约定或实现方式,例如在某些平台上可能是 `CurrentBarsCount()` 或其他形式,请根据实际情况调整代码。---
总结`currbarscount` 是一个简单而实用的函数,能够帮助开发者快速获取数据集的条目数量。无论是在金融数据分析、时间序列处理还是其他领域,合理使用 `currbarscount` 都能提高代码的效率和可读性。通过理解其语法、应用场景以及注意事项,可以更好地将其融入到实际开发中。
本文系作者授权tatn.cn发表,未经许可,不得转载。